Applications Now Available for the California State Summer School for Mathematics and Science (COSMOS)
COSMOS is a unique opportunity for
motivated high school students to participate in a four-week summer residential
program. COSMOS is seeking academically talented students who are interested in
science, technology, engineering, and math to participate in an academic
enrichment program. The program is open to rising 8th through rising 12th graders.
Financial assistance is available. Students may apply online until March 15th
at http://www.ucop.edu/cosmos.
The COSMOS program is hosted at UC Davis, UC Irvine, UC Santa Cruz, and UC San
Diego. The program dates for UCSD COSMOS are July 10th - August 6th. High
school teachers are also invited to apply for COSMOS Teacher Fellow positions.
The Teacher Fellows work with COSMOS students and university faculty teams
during the program period. Teacher Fellows receive a $4500 stipend as well as
the opportunity to receive funding for classroom supplies and projects. The UCSD
COSMOS Teacher Fellow application can be accessed at http://www.jacobsschool.ucsd.edu/cosmos/academics/fellowships.shtml
and the application deadline is February 14th.
